    FAQs about Croatia power station energy storage project bidding

    Who owns a power station in Croatia?

    All power stations in Croatia are owned and operated by Hrvatska elektroprivreda (HEP), the national power company. As of 2015, HEP operates 26 hydroelectric, 4 thermal and 3 cogenerating power plants with the total installed electrical power of 3.654 MW.

    Did Croatia get the green light for IE-energy's massive energy storage project?

    Croatia got the green light from Brussels for a EUR 19.8 million grant to IE-Energy for a massive energy storage project.

    Will ie-energy accelerate the decarbonization of Croatia's energy sector?

    In addition, it will accelerate the decarbonization of the Croatian energy sector, according to the announcement. IE-Energy is based in Rijeka, Croatia's fourth-largest city. It joined the intraday and day-ahead markets at the Croatian Power Exchange (CROPEX) last year. Documents reveal the project is scheduled to start on December 1.

    Will ie-energy be the biggest energy storage project in southeastern Europe?

    Croatia got the green light from Brussels to give a EUR 19.8 million grant to a domestic startup for a massive energy storage project. IE-Energy is planning to build a battery system of 50 MW, which means it would be the biggest in Southeastern Europe.

    Will ie-energy build the biggest battery system in southeastern Europe?

    IE-Energy is planning to build a battery system of 50 MW, which means it would be the biggest in Southeastern Europe. The European Commission has approved, under the European Union's aid rules, a EUR 19.8 million Croatian aid measure in favor of energy storage operator IE-Energy.

    Will ie-energy boost storage capacity in southeastern Europe by 2024?

    Moreover, IE-Energy said it would boost the system to 50 MW and 110 MWh by 2024. There is no storage facility in Southeastern Europe yet with such a capacity. Of note, a 250 MW project is under development in Turkey, with an envisaged capacity of 1 GWh.

    United Arab Emirates BESS energy storage project bidding

    Utility EWEC (Emirates Water and Electricity Company) has invited developers to submit expressions of interest (EOI) for a 400MW battery energy storage system (BESS) project in the UAE.


    FAQs about United Arab Emirates BESS energy storage project bidding

    Will the UAE deploy 300mw/300mw of Bess capacity by 2026?

    It follows EWEC's recommendation made this time last year that the UAE should deploy 300MW/300MWh of BESS capacity by 2026. It didn't reveal when it hoped the 400MW (MWh capacity undisclosed) would come online, so it's not clear whether this is part of a longer-term target or whether its forecasted needs have increased.

    Why is EWEC deploying Bess in Abu Dhabi?

    "Ewec is deploying bess to enhance the flexibility and stability of Abu Dhabi's energy network, allowing for the effective management of peak demand and integration of increasing amounts of renewable energy," the utility said in a media statement on 25 July.

Emirates Water and Electricity Co. (EWEC) has started accepting expressions of interest for a 400 MW battery energy storage system (BESS).

    How do I submit an EOI for a 400MW Bess project?

    Interested parties should submit their EOI to [email protected], after which EWEC will issue a request for qualifications to parties wishing to proceed to the next stage. Utility EWEC has invited developers to submit expressions of interest (EOI) for a 400MW BESS project in the UAE.

    What is EWEC's new energy storage facility?

    The planned facility is expected to provide up to 800 megawatt-hours (MWh) of storage capacity. Called Bess 1, the project will closely follow the model of Ewec's independent power project (IPP) programme, in which developers enter into a long-term energy storage agreement (ESA) with Ewec as the sole procurer.

    What is a Bess Power Purchase Agreement (PPA)?

    The project will involve the development, financing, construction, operation, maintenance and ownership of the BESS system and associated infrastructure, with EWEC then entering into a long-term power purchase agreement (PPA) for the project's offtake.

    Construction of a utility-scale solar-plus-storage project is now underway in northern Togo. The 25 MW Dapong solar project will include 36,000 solar panels across 52 hectares, along with 36 MWh of battery energy storage. It is expected to serve about 145,000 people in the city of. This agreement will finance feasibility studies for a battery energy storage system (BESS) project in Togo – a crucial step to integrate more renewable energy and achieve universal access to electricity by 2030. Announced in Washington during the IMF and World Bank Annual Meetings, the 55 MW project supports the national “Mission 300” plan to achieve universal electricity. (Togo First) - Togo is set to pilot a green energy storage program after the French Development Agency and the Global Energy Alliance for People and Planet (GEAPP) signed an agreement for 112 million CFA francs ($200,000) to finance feasibility studies.
